In a retrospective analysis of endoscopic cholangiograms in 66 patients with pancreatic disease we found sclerosing-cholangitis-like changes in 83% of cases. Excluding patients with intrapancreatic constriction of the distal common bile duct, 70% of patients with chronic pancreatitis, 60% with acute pancreatitis and 100% with pancreatic cancer had these abnormalities. The possible significance of these changes, which are unlikely to be secondary to pancreatic disease, are discussed with reference to the published literature on sclerosing cholangitis.Entities:
